Output 6e586ca2601d8eae1d2b7e77f7d261cc60eed06fe65941f70135b8c33dcb1276:0

value
870898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54a51bc4d1a7f2cfec67bf716ac3eb3d1f26d28 OP_EQUAL
address
3M8ntCRKKarSLd8uXxMB2VYFEBvF12hArz
transaction
6e586ca2601d8eae1d2b7e77f7d261cc60eed06fe65941f70135b8c33dcb1276
confirmations
359017
spent
true